Inovant to Vet Visa Transactions with ILOG JRules
Inovant, the
IT arm of Visa International, is integrating ILOG
JRules business rule software into the automated functionality
of the subsidiarys new Web-based profile management system.
The rule component will enable Inovant to better maintain the business-policy
logic governing Visas electronic interaction with its 21,000
member banks.
The new profile management system is part of a complete overhaul
of VisaNet, the worlds largest and most sophisticated consumer
financial transaction processing system. Inovant operates the global
transaction-processing network supporting Visas products.
ILOG JRules will be used to automate the complex validation tasks
associated with clearing transactions.

Inovants non-technical personnel will benefit from the customizable
rule language support of ILOG JRules, which allows them to quickly
update VisaNet in response to rapid changes in the market and customer
demand. Also, ILOG JRules externalizes business rules, allowing
them to be written and then integrated with VisaNet without taking
the application offline.
ILOG JRules supports the creation of flexible,
adaptable business rule syntaxes. This unique capability lets business
users write rules using easy-to-understand rule terminology tailored
to their own industry, rather than a one-size-fits-all business
rule language.
Paired with ILOG JRules Rule Editor, a rule language editor that
has an intuitive GUI, rule creation is greatly simplified. Other
key features of the product include support for eXtensible Markup
Language (XML), for the sharing of business rules on the Web, and
Enterprise Java Beans, for applications running on the Java Standard
Enterprise Edition platform.
